Sand Spreading: The A Lot Of Typical Technique



Although numerous casting methods exist, sand spreading stays the most common technique in the industry due to its convenience and cost-effectiveness. This approach employs sand as a primary mold and mildew material, enabling the creation of intricate forms and big components. The process starts with the formation of a mold, commonly made from a blend of sand and a binding representative. As soon as the mold is ready, molten metal is put into the tooth cavity, loading every detail of the design.


After the metal cools down and solidifies, the mold is broken away to expose the final casting. Sand spreading is specifically preferred for its capacity to fit a vast array of metals, including iron, light weight aluminum, and steel. Furthermore, it appropriates for both small-scale manufacturing and huge quantities, making it an optimal selection for industries such as automotive, aerospace, and building and construction. Die Casting: High-Volume Production





Pass away casting becomes a substantial technique for high-volume production, specifically in sectors needing precision-engineered elements. This method entails forcing molten steel under high stress into a mold dental caries, causing get rid of exceptional dimensional precision and surface area coating. Typically used with non-ferrous steels such as aluminum, magnesium, and zinc, die spreading is favored for its ability to generate intricate forms with marginal machining requirements.


The procedure permits rapid production cycles, making it excellent for manufacturing huge quantities of components efficiently. Pass away casting is widely used in automotive, aerospace, and customer electronic devices markets, where reliability and repeatability are essential. Additionally, advancements in innovation have caused enhanced mold and mildew styles and materials, boosting the toughness and life expectancy of the molds. Generally, die spreading sticks out as a vital strategy for makers aiming to fulfill high manufacturing demands while keeping quality and cost-effectiveness in their procedures.

History of Lost Wax



Amongst the myriad steel spreading strategies, shed wax casting stands apart for its one-of-a-kind creative expression and rich historical origins. This technique, believed to day back over 5,000 years, has actually been used by numerous people, including the old Egyptians, Greeks, and Chinese. Employed for creating complex precious jewelry and ritualistic things, shed wax spreading permitted artisans to reproduce detailed designs with accuracy. The process includes shaping a model in wax, which is after that encased in a mold. When heated, the wax thaws away, leaving a tooth cavity for liquified steel. This method not only showcases the skill of the artist but additionally highlights the social significance of metalwork throughout history, influencing modern practices in sculpture and design.


Process Steps Described



The intricate process of shed wax spreading involves a number of carefully managed steps that change a wax design into a stunning metal artifact. Initially, a musician creates a detailed wax version, which works as the layout for the final item. This version is after that coated with a refractory material to develop a mold, complied with by heating to permit the wax to thaw and recede, leaving a hollow cavity. Next, liquified metal is poured into the mold and mildew, filling deep space left by the wax. Once the metal cools down and solidifies, the mold and mildew is damaged away to disclose the completed item. Finally, any required finishing touches, such as sprucing up and surface treatment, are related to enhance the piece's visual appeal and durability.
